Series D funding for Catalym

The biotech startup Catalym successfully closes its Series D funding round for 138 million euros. The funding round was led by Canaan Partners and Bioqube Ventures.

Catalym secures 50 million euros

Catalym raises 50 million euros in a Series C round. The biotech startup based in Martinsried plans to invest the newly raised capital in further clinical testing of its drug candidate Visugromab.
